Just Listed in Kennebunkport!

The 1802 House Bed and Breakfast Inn is a historic, independent property in the beautiful seaside town of Kennebunkport Maine. The house is of original Colonial design and as the name implies, was built in 1802. Extensions were added over the years, and in the 1990s it was converted into the charming bed and breakfast
